Color Guide: How to Use Navy Blue

Solid, steadfast navy blue can ground a room, but it still knows how to have a good time

Navy is the darkest blue and in its true form appears almost black. It gets its name from the uniforms of the British Royal Navy and is associated with uniforms, dress clothing and other traditional sartorial choices.

Navy is an elegant and serious color, and it evokes serious things like tradition, solidity and strength. It is definitely a masculine color. But it doesn't have to be somber. Pair it with crisp white and you get a brisk maritime feel — think yachting with the Kennedys. Put it with bright colors — lime green, bright pink and sunny yellow look great with navy — and you get something modern and vivacious.

Navy is extremely versatile and works in almost every style of decor. Use it on the walls when you want to go dark but not quite black. Use it as a contrast against white trim and interesting architectural details. Use it as a way to give a boring box more depth and interest.

Its very close relative, indigo, is often used interchangeably with navy and is seen in many traditional designs and arts. Traditional Japanese shibori cloth is very close to navy, and many Indian and South American designs incorporate it too. Because of this, it can go boho, eclectic and exotic as well.

Navy on the Walls

Good lighting brings out the color in navy and keeps it from looking chalky or black. This navy-on-navy thing looks elegant and modern.

Navy in the Kitchen

Navy cabinets are an unexpected but still traditional take on the usual browns.
Michael Goodsmith Design
The high-gloss version looks sleek and design minded in this modern kitchen.
A navy tile backsplash in an otherwise all-white kitchen. The space has a seafaring vibe, but it's not at all like a galley.

    I painted my kitchen a shiny navy blue and loved it for about a year, but then it just got oppressive. After the sun went down it was very cave like and depressing. I repainted it yellow and was much happier. Also, think about how you are ever going to cover it. I'd suggest using this glorious color as an accent instead of for a whole room.
